Dividing a 401(k) plan in divorce isn’t just about splitting the numbers down the middle. When it comes to plans like the Knoxville Hospital and Clinics Tax Sheltered Annuity Plan, you need a QDRO that addresses contributions, vesting, loan balances, and tax distinctions. Missing any of these details can result in significant financial loss for one or both parties.
